Viruses with Cancer-Inducing Potential

Not all viruses lead to cancer, but some are notorious for their ability to cause malignant growths in s. Among them are Papillomavirus HPV, HIV, Hepatitis B virus HBV, and Hepatitis C virus HCV. These pathogens have been implicated in the development of various cancers through intricate biological mechanisms.

HPV and Cancer Risk

Papillomavirus, particularly certn strns like HPV16 and 18, are well-known for their role in cervical cancer. By infecting epithelial cellsprimarily those found in the skin and mucosal surfacesthe virus can lead to long-term cellular damage, sometimes turning normal cells into precancerous lesions or full-blown cancer.

HIV and Cancer Risk

Immunodeficiency Virus HIV has a more indirect relationship with cancer. While it doesn't directly cause cancer, individuals living with HIV are at higher risk for certn cancers due to compromised immune function. HIV weakens the body's defense mechanisms, making individuals susceptible to infections that can lead to malignancies.

Hepatitis Viruses and Cancer Risk

Hepatitis B virus HBV and HCV have been linked to liver cancer primarily. Persistent infection with these viruses is known to cause chronic inflammation in the liver, which over time can lead to cirrhosis and an increased risk of developing hepatocellular carcinomaa type of liver cancer.

The Mechanism Behind Viral-Induced Cancer

While each virus has its unique mode of action leading to oncogenesis, they all share a common thread. By interacting with host cells, these viruses manipulate cellular pathways that control cell growth and division. This can lead to uncontrolled proliferation and the development of malignancies.
